California auto insurance companies are obligated to distribute policies with
liability coverage of 15/30/5. A lot of drivers prefer to raise this coverage with the intention of protecting their residences and other
possessions. The Internet can offer vast options when deciding what type of coverage works best.
California auto insurance companies also tender optional coverage such as medical payments, collision, comprehensive, and
protection against uninsured motorists. Despite the fact that these may not be a state prerequisite, they could represent the distinction between
someone keeping their home or filing for bankruptcy.
It is a prudent thought to include medical payment coverage along with the car insurance policy, considering the fact that medical attention can
cost thousands of dollars. With this approach, consumers won't have to be anxious about an accident victim filing a lawsuit for thousands of
dollars that their insurance policy doesn't include. Collision coverage is a critical element to any insurance policy as it covers the damages
done to the account holder's own car in the event of an accident. Without collision coverage, people will not be able to meet the expense of
having their own car repaired.
On the other hand, comprehensive insurance covers other inopportune auto incidents such as theft, natural disaster, and fire. With this coverage,
people are able to replace what was stolen or have their car repaired for only the cost of their deductible.
Uninsured motorist coverage safeguards people in case their car should meet with an accident with somebody who does not have car insurance. This
